      • Flexible Programming Environment:
        • Compliant with IEC 61131-3 international programming standards.
        • Supports all five standard languages: Ladder Diagram (LD), Function Block Diagram (FBD), Structured Text (ST), Instruction List (IL), and Sequential Function Chart (SFC).
